    Understanding the Costs at Deep Dive Dubai

    Alright, so let's cut to the chase: how much will it cost you to experience the wonders of Deep Dive Dubai? The prices vary depending on the activity you choose, your experience level, and the time of day. Generally, you can expect to pay anywhere from $100 to $600+ per person. I know, that's a pretty wide range, but trust me, there's a good reason for it!

    Firstly, there are different diving experiences available. If you're a complete beginner, you can opt for a "Discover Scuba Diving" experience, which will introduce you to the basics of scuba diving. These sessions are usually shorter and less expensive. If you're already a certified diver, you can choose from a variety of dives, including recreational dives and technical dives. Naturally, these dives require more expertise and specialized equipment, so they tend to be pricier. The time of day also plays a role in the pricing. Peak hours, such as weekends and evenings, are usually more expensive than weekdays and mornings. Also, keep an eye out for any special promotions or packages that Deep Dive Dubai might be running, as they can sometimes offer discounts on certain activities or combinations of activities. It’s always a good idea to check their official website for the most up-to-date pricing information.

    Now, let's break down some of the specific costs you can expect:

    • Discover Scuba Diving: This is a great option for beginners. Expect to pay around $100 - $200 for a session that includes an instructor, all the necessary equipment, and a brief introduction to scuba diving. This is a fantastic way to experience the underwater world without any prior certification.
    • Certified Scuba Diving: If you're a certified diver, you can enjoy a variety of dives at Deep Dive Dubai. The cost typically ranges from $150 - $400+ depending on the depth, duration, and any equipment rentals. Remember, the deeper you go and the more specialized the equipment, the higher the price.
    • Freediving: For those who prefer to explore the depths without scuba gear, Deep Dive Dubai also offers freediving sessions. The prices for these sessions usually range from $150 - $300, which includes access to the pool, coaching, and equipment.
    • Equipment Rental: While some packages include equipment rental, others may require you to rent gear separately. The cost for renting equipment like wetsuits, regulators, and BCDs can range from $20 - $50 per item, so factor this into your budget.

    Keep in mind that these prices are approximate and can change. Always check the official Deep Dive Dubai website for the most accurate and up-to-date pricing information. Also, consider the currency exchange rates, as these prices are typically listed in United Arab Emirates Dirhams (AED).

    What's Included in the Price?

    So, what do you actually get for your money when you visit Deep Dive Dubai? It's essential to know what's included in the price to understand the value you're receiving. Typically, your fee covers access to the incredible pool, which is, of course, the main attraction! But there's more to it than just that.

    For most scuba diving experiences, the price usually includes the following:

    • Pool Access: Entry to the Deep Dive Dubai facility and, obviously, the pool itself.
    • Instructor/Guide: A certified instructor or dive guide to lead your dive and ensure your safety. They provide briefings, guide you through the underwater environment, and offer assistance as needed.
    • Equipment (sometimes): Depending on the package, the price may include the rental of essential scuba diving gear, such as a wetsuit, BCD (buoyancy control device), regulator, mask, fins, and a weight belt. Be sure to check what's included in your chosen package.
    • Air Tank: The price includes a full air tank for your dive.
    • Briefing/Training: A pre-dive briefing from your instructor, covering safety procedures, dive plans, and information about the underwater environment. For beginners, this will also include basic scuba diving skills training.

    For freediving sessions, the price generally includes:

    • Pool Access: Same as scuba diving.
    • Instructor/Coach: A freediving instructor to guide your session and provide coaching.
    • Equipment: The rental of essential freediving equipment, such as a wetsuit, mask, fins, and a weight belt. Check the package details.

    Additional inclusions may vary depending on the package you choose, but could also include:

    • Refreshments: Some packages may offer complimentary drinks or snacks.
    • Photos/Videos: Certain packages may include professional photos or videos of your dive.
    • Souvenirs: In some cases, you might receive a small souvenir to remember your experience.
